mxengineer1 Added a reply to Husqvarna Off-Road Bike Question - Are the 2021s 10mm lower or not?
10/22/2020 6:45am Only the moto FC250/350/450 got the lowered suspension for 2021. No change to the '21 off road TX/TE models or '21 FX350/450 bikes

10/28/2019 4:48pm I have the small "ebike" version of this, the Sur Ron X, and it's an absolute blast to ride. 110lbs with a removable battery and takes about 3 hrs to charge and gets about 2 hrs or 40 miles of ride time. No engine maintenance is nice and I can ride it through the neighborhood and nobody cares. I can even take it on the sidewalk at slow speed and people just wave hello.
